Ginger benefits our body and health you should know.

Ginger is one of the most delicious and nutritious spices.

It is a flowering plant that originated in China.

Turmeric, cardomon and galangal are very similar in appearance and taste.

It is a well-known natural herbal medicine that has been used since time immemorial.

It is said to help with digestion, nausea, flu, colds and many more.

It is also one of the missing ingredients in Filipino cuisine due to its unique taste and aroma that gives it appetite.

It can be used with fresh, dried, powdered, oil or juice.

It can also be seen sometimes in processed foods or in cosmetics products.

According to studies, eating ginger has many beneficial effects on a person's body.

Some of the ginger benefits for the body and health are as follows

Benefits of ginger in the body

1. Ginger contains a substance called gingerol that has powerful medicinal properties

The smell and taste of ginger comes from its natural oils and one of them is the so-called gingerol.

It is also the main bioactive compound in ginger with powerful medicinal properties.

Like the anti-inflammatory and antioxidant properties our body needs.

2. It is an effective remedy for nausea or nausea such as morning sickness in pregnant women

According to the study, 1-1.5 grams of ginger can help prevent various types of nausea or nausea.

These include sea sickness, chemotherapy-related nausea, nausea caused by surgery and morning sickness in pregnant women.

Although it is a natural herbal medicine, it is advisable to talk to a doctor first before consuming large amounts of ginger when pregnant.

Because according to some, the large amount of ginger can cause miscarriage.

3. It helps to relieve swelling and pain in the muscles

One study said that 2 grams of ginger a day for 11 days can help relieve muscle pain.

It will not cause a quick effect but it does help to reduce the inflammation of the mucles especially caused by exercise.

4. The inflammatory effects of ginger are also helpful for those with osteoarthritis

One study said that ginger benefits when mixed with mastic, sesame oil and cinnamon are effective in relieving the pain and stiffness caused by osteoarthritis when applied to the skin.

5. Ginger has powerful anti-diabetic properties

Another wonderful benefit of ginger is that it lowers the blood sugar levels in the body which also lowers the chances of a person having heart disease.

According to a 2015 study, 2 grams of ginger per day lowers blood sugar by up to 12%.

6. Ginger can also treat chronic indigestion and other related stomach discomfort

Chronic indigestion is the recurrent pain in the upper abdomen.

This is said to be due to the slow digestion of food which causes slow or delayed bowel movements.

In a study conducted on 24 healthy individuals, 1.2grams of ginger powder was found before a meal to speed up digestion and bowel movements by 50%.

Meanwhile, eating ginger soup can speed up digestion or bowel movements from 16 to 12 minutes.

7. Ginger is also good as a pain relief for dysmenorrhea

Another benefit of ginger especially in women is its treatment of the pain caused by menstruation or dysmenorrhea.

One gram of ginger powder per day for the first three days of menstruation can reduce the pain caused by dysmenorrhea.

Such effects can be produced by mefenamic acid and ibuprofen, according to one study.

8. Ginger also lowers the body's cholesterol level

A 45-day study of 85 people with high cholesterol found that 3grams of ginger powder causes significant reduction of cholesterol markers in the body.

This was supported by another study in hypothyroid rats which found that ginger extract lowers LDL cholesterol just as the drug atorvastatin does.

9. Ginger has a substance that helps prevent cancer

Ginger extract is considered an alternative treatment for uncontrollable growth of abnormal cells in the body.

A study of 30 individuals found that 2grams of ginger extract per day reduces pro-inflammatory signaling molecules in our colon.

Ginger also contains 6-gingerol substance with anti-cancer properties that can fight pancreatic cancer, breast cancer and ovarian cancer.

10. Ginger also improves brain function and protects against Alzheimer’s disease

According to studies, ginger anti-oxidants and bioactive compounds inhibit inflammatory responses that occur in the brain.

This is believed to be the cause of Alzheimer’s disease and age-related brain function decline.

A study of 60 middle-aged women also found that ginger extract enhances brain function by improving reaction time and working memory.

11. Ginger is also a good protection against infection

The active ingredient of gingerol gingerol is also good against infection.

Because it prevents the growth of different types of bacteria.

It is most effective against oral bacteria associated with inflammatory diseases of the gums such as gingivitis and periodontitis.

Fresh ginger is also good against the RSV virus that causes respiratory infections.
